A ball is thrown horizontally from a height h. The time to reach the ground depends on:

Answer: Vertical height only.

  • A Horizontal speed only
  • B Both horizontal and vertical
  • C Vertical height only
  • D Neither

Correct answer: C. Vertical height only

Explanation: Time to fall depends only on vertical height h: t = √(2h/g). Horizontal speed does not affect fall time.

Projectile trajectories launched at 15, 30, 45, 60, 75 and 90 degrees at the same speed, each annotated with range R, maximum height H and time of flight T, with coloured dots marking equal time intervals

Projectiles at equal speed: range is maximum at 45°, and complementary angles (30° and 60°) share the same range. Image: Cmglee, CC BY-SA 3.0, via Wikimedia Commons.
